@@ -345,12 +357,27 @@ static int verb_pkcs7(int argc, char *argv[], void *userdata) {
if (r < 0)
return log_error_errno(r, "Failed to allocate PKCS#7 context: %m");
if (PKCS7_set_detached(pkcs7, true) == 0)
return log_error_errno(SYNTHETIC_ERRNO(EIO), "Failed to set PKCS#7 detached attribute: %s",
ERR_error_string(ERR_get_error(), NULL));
if (arg_content) {
_cleanup_free_ char *content = NULL;
size_t content_len = 0;
r = read_full_file(arg_content, &content, &content_len);
if (r < 0)
return log_error_errno(r, "Failed to read content file %s: %m", arg_content);
if (content_len == 0)
return log_error_errno(SYNTHETIC_ERRNO(EIO), "Content file %s is empty", arg_content);
if (!PKCS7_content_new(pkcs7, NID_pkcs7_data))
return log_error_errno(SYNTHETIC_ERRNO(EIO), "Error creating new PKCS7 content field");
ASN1_STRING_set0(pkcs7->d.sign->contents->d.data, TAKE_PTR(content), content_len);
} else
if (PKCS7_set_detached(pkcs7, true) == 0)
return log_error_errno(SYNTHETIC_ERRNO(EIO),
"Failed to set PKCS#7 detached attribute: %s",
ERR_error_string(ERR_get_error(), NULL));
/* Add PKCS1 signature to PKCS7_SIGNER_INFO */
ASN1_STRING_set0(signer_info->enc_digest, TAKE_PTR(pkcs1), pkcs1_len);

@@ -53,7 +53,7 @@ testcase_pkcs7() {
# Generate PKCS#1 signature
openssl dgst -sha256 -sign /tmp/test.key -out /tmp/payload.sig /tmp/payload
# Generate PKCS#7 signature
# Generate PKCS#7 "detached" signature
/usr/lib/systemd/systemd-keyutil --certificate /tmp/test.crt --output /tmp/payload.p7s --signature /tmp/payload.sig pkcs7
# Verify using internal x509 certificate
@@ -61,6 +61,17 @@ testcase_pkcs7() {
# Verify using external (original) x509 certificate
openssl smime -verify -binary -inform der -in /tmp/payload.p7s -content /tmp/payload -certificate /tmp/test.crt -nointern -noverify > /dev/null
rm -f /tmp/payload.p7s
# Generate PKCS#7 non-"detached" signature
/usr/lib/systemd/systemd-keyutil --certificate /tmp/test.crt --output /tmp/payload.p7s --signature /tmp/payload.sig --content /tmp/payload pkcs7
# Verify using internal x509 certificate
openssl smime -verify -binary -inform der -in /tmp/payload.p7s -noverify > /dev/null
# Verify using external (original) x509 certificate
openssl smime -verify -binary -inform der -in /tmp/payload.p7s -certificate /tmp/test.crt -nointern -noverify > /dev/null
}
